数据库的模式有什么用

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库的模式在数据库设计中起着非常重要的作用。它定义了数据库中数据的组织方式和结构,包括数据表的定义、字段的定义、关系的定义等。数据库的模式有以下几个重要的用途:

    1. 数据一致性:数据库的模式可以确保数据在数据库中的一致性。通过定义数据表的结构和约束条件,可以限制数据的输入和操作,避免数据的冗余、不一致和错误。

    2. 数据安全性:数据库的模式可以提供数据的安全性。通过定义用户和权限,可以限制用户对数据库的访问和操作,确保只有授权的用户才能进行数据的读取和修改,从而保护数据的安全。

    3. 数据查询和分析:数据库的模式可以优化数据的查询和分析。通过合理设计数据表和索引,可以提高查询的效率,加快数据的检索和分析速度。

    4. 数据的可扩展性:数据库的模式可以支持数据的可扩展性。通过合理设计数据表和关系,可以方便地添加新的数据表和字段,扩展数据库的功能和容量,适应业务的发展和变化。

    5. 数据的维护和管理:数据库的模式可以简化数据的维护和管理。通过定义数据表和关系,可以方便地对数据进行增删改查操作,简化了数据的维护和管理工作,提高了数据的可管理性和可维护性。

    综上所述,数据库的模式在数据库设计和管理中起着非常重要的作用,它可以确保数据的一致性和安全性,优化数据的查询和分析,支持数据的可扩展性,简化数据的维护和管理。在实际应用中,合理设计和使用数据库的模式,可以提高数据库的性能和效率,提升系统的稳定性和可靠性。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    数据库的模式是数据库中定义和组织数据的结构和约束的集合。它对于数据库的设计和管理非常重要,具有以下几个作用:

    1. 数据结构定义:模式定义了数据库中的表、字段、关系和约束等数据结构的组织方式。通过模式,可以清晰地定义和描述数据库中数据的结构,使数据库的设计更加规范和统一。

    2. 数据完整性保证:模式中的约束条件可以保证数据库中数据的完整性和一致性。例如,可以定义字段的数据类型、长度和取值范围,以及表之间的关系和约束条件,从而避免了非法数据的插入和更新,确保数据的质量和准确性。

    3. 数据访问控制:模式可以定义数据库中的用户、角色和权限等访问控制策略。通过模式,可以限制用户对数据库的访问和操作权限,保护数据库的安全性和隐私性。

    4. 数据查询和操作优化:模式可以帮助数据库系统优化查询和操作的性能。通过对数据的结构和关系进行合理的设计和组织,可以减少数据存储和访问的开销,提高数据库的查询和操作效率。

    5. 数据库的演化和扩展:模式可以支持数据库的演化和扩展。通过模式,可以方便地修改和调整数据库的结构,满足业务需求的变化和扩展。

    总之,数据库的模式在数据库的设计、管理和应用中起着重要的作用,它定义了数据库中数据的结构和约束,保证了数据的完整性和一致性,控制了数据的访问和操作权限,优化了数据的查询和操作性能,支持了数据库的演化和扩展。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库的模式是指数据库中的结构和组织方式,它定义了数据表、字段、关系、约束等元素的布局和规范。数据库的模式有以下几个作用:

    1. 数据组织和管理:模式定义了数据库中数据的组织方式,包括数据表的结构、字段的类型和约束等。通过模式,可以规范和管理数据的存储和访问方式,使得数据能够被有效地组织和管理。

    2. 数据一致性和完整性:模式定义了数据表之间的关系和约束,包括主键、外键、唯一性约束等。通过模式,可以确保数据的一致性和完整性,避免数据冗余和不一致的情况。

    3. 数据查询和操作:模式定义了数据表和字段的结构,可以帮助用户进行数据查询和操作。通过模式,用户可以了解数据库中的数据结构,从而更方便地进行数据查询和操作。

    4. 数据安全和权限控制:模式定义了数据表和字段的权限和访问控制规则。通过模式,可以限制用户对数据库的访问权限,保护数据的安全性。

    5. 数据库维护和优化:模式可以提供给数据库管理员进行数据库维护和性能优化的依据。通过模式,管理员可以了解数据库的结构和组织方式,从而进行数据库的备份、恢复、性能调优等操作。

    总之,数据库的模式是数据库设计的基础,它定义了数据库中数据的结构和组织方式,提供了数据的一致性、完整性、安全性和可维护性。通过合理设计和使用数据库的模式,可以提高数据库的效率和可靠性,满足用户的需求。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部